Organization Overview

The Directorate Purchase and Stores (DPS) operates as a critical support service for the Department of Atomic Energy (DAE), which oversees India's nuclear and atomic energy programs. DPS ensures the timely and efficient acquisition of a wide array of items, ranging from sophisticated scientific instruments to general office supplies, necessary for research, development, and operational activities across DAE institutions like Bhabha Atomic Research Centre (BARC), Indira Gandhi Centre for Atomic Research (IGCAR), and others. Its role is fundamental to the success of national scientific endeavors.

Key Job Profiles

DPS offers various career opportunities for professionals in diverse fields. Some of the typical job roles include:

  • Purchase Officer: Responsible for tendering, procurement, and contract management.
  • Stores Officer: Manages inventory, warehousing, and stock control.
  • Administrative Officer: Handles administrative tasks, personnel, and general management.
  • Scientific Officer (various disciplines): Involved in technical procurement and material management, often requiring specific scientific qualifications.
  • Technical Assistant/Officer: Supports procurement and stores operations with technical expertise.
